"S Powell" wrote in message m...
I'm looking for a puncture resistant 700x23c tire. I'm currently riding a
Mondo tire, which has a soft rubber and flint stones are constantly working
their way through the tire. If you have any recommendations, please let me
know.


I have used Specialized Armadillos with much success. I have one set
with more than 8000 miles and no puncture flats. You can order them
directly from Specialized web site.

Opinions vary on these tires. Do a Google search to read others
opinions.
